Student opportunities available with LU Arts

LU Arts are currently looking for students to fulfil roles in two areas, starting in the next academic year.

Steering Group

If you are interested in helping shape and progress LU Arts, you may be a perfect member for the new Steering Group. This voluntary position will include taking part in creative activities, attending monthly meetings, and influencing the LU Arts programme.

The department hosts events with international artists, National Theatre Live screenings, Radar, Speech Bubble, and countless other student and staff opportunities. Within this role, you can help with improvements and create new ideas for LU Arts.

In return you will receive discounted or free event tickets, creative and learning opportunities, work experience and a CV boost, as well as hearing first about paid work opportunities for students. The first meeting will take place in October 2017 and students can join on a rolling basis.

 

Online Assistant

The second available role is of Online Assistant, which is paid £8.34 per hour. Working up to six hours a week during term time, the role can fit flexibly around your studies. This post is available as two placements and the first would start in September.

You will help LU Arts’ student outreach, maximise event attendance and raise the programme profile by creating online content, producing short videos and extending communications. Other activities will include writing posts for Facebook, Twitter and Instagram, as well as writing reviews or securing reviews from other students. You will be expected to take part in the steering group, and attend events.

This opportunity will provide you with new skills, work experience, a CV boost, a work reference and professional mentoring.
